Paper Procurement
If your company has multiple national or global locations, and if you purchase high volumes of print directly using either a centralised or decentralised order process, it’s likely that Graphic Communications can save you money. Quite possibly, a lot of money.
Even if your organisation has discovered the significant savings of unbundling your paper and print spend, Graphic has paper purchasing power that’s virtually unmatched by any other company. Paper can be more than half the cost of printing, so when you save on it, you can really save.
GC’s international division represents an exhaustive list of papers ranging from newsprint to woodfree. We also have direct, daily communication with decision makers from more than 15 of Europe’s leading mills and access to the widest possible grade varieties. Our extensive experience comes not only from working for one of the largest paper distributors in the world, but also from working for the paper manufacturers themselves.
